public List <ExpedienteConocimiento> CHU_Expediente_Conocimiento_Consultar(ExpedienteConocimiento Expediente) { List <ExpedienteConocimiento> oList = new List <ExpedienteConocimiento>(); try { using (SqlConnection conn = new SqlConnection(RecuperarCadenaDeConexion("coneccionSQL"))) { conn.Open(); using (SqlCommand cmd = new SqlCommand(CONS_USP_CHU_EXPEDIENTE_CONOCIMIENTOS_OBTENER, conn)) { cmd.Parameters.AddWithValue("@Id", Expediente.IdExpediente); cmd.CommandType = CommandType.StoredProcedure; using (SqlDataReader reader = cmd.ExecuteReader()) { while (reader.Read()) { ExpedienteConocimiento obj = new ExpedienteConocimiento(); obj.IdExpediente = int.Parse(reader["EXP_Id"].ToString()); obj.Idioma = reader["ECO_Idioma"].ToString(); obj.Porcentaje = int.Parse(reader["ECO_Porcentaje"].ToString()); obj.Maquinas = reader["ECO_Maquinas"].ToString(); obj.Funciones = reader["ECO_Funciones"].ToString(); obj.Software = reader["ECO_Software"].ToString(); obj.Otros = reader["ECO_Otros"].ToString(); oList.Add(obj); } } } } return(oList); } catch (Exception ex) { throw ex; } }
public List <ExpedienteConocimiento> CHU_Expediente_Conocimiento_Consultar(ExpedienteConocimiento Expediente) { return(new ExpedientesBP().CHU_Expediente_Conocimiento_Consultar(Expediente)); }